*** empty log message ***
[m17n/m17n-lib.git] / src / m17n-gui.h
index 1303747..efe9846 100644 (file)
@@ -32,7 +32,7 @@ extern "C"
 {
 #endif
 
-extern int m17n_init_win (void);
+extern void m17n_init_win (void);
 #undef M17N_INIT
 #define M17N_INIT() m17n_init_win ()
 
@@ -151,10 +151,6 @@ extern MFont *mfont_parse_name (char *name, MSymbol format);
 
 extern char *mfont_unparse_name (MFont *font, MSymbol format);
 
-extern MFont *mfont_from_spec (char *family, char *weight, char *slant,
-                              char *swidth, char *adstyle, char *registry,
-                              unsigned short point, unsigned short res);
-
 /* These two are obsolete (from 1.1.0).  */
 extern char *mfont_name (MFont *font);
 extern MFont *mfont_from_name (char *name);
@@ -217,6 +213,10 @@ extern int mfont_set_selection_priority (MSymbol *keys);
 
 extern int mfont_resize_ratio (MFont *font);
 
+extern MPlist *mfont_list (MFrame *frame, MFont *font, MSymbol language,
+                          int maxnum);
+
+
 /* end of font module */
 /*=*/
 
@@ -224,7 +224,8 @@ extern int mfont_resize_ratio (MFont *font);
 /***en @defgroup m17nFontset Fontset */
 /***ja @defgroup m17nFontset ¥Õ¥©¥ó¥È¥»¥Ã¥È */
 /*=*/
-
+/*** @addtogroup m17nFontset
+     @{   */
 typedef struct MFontset MFontset;
 
 extern MFontset *mfontset (char *name);
@@ -241,7 +242,7 @@ extern int mfontset_modify_entry (MFontset *fontset,
 
 extern MPlist *mfontset_lookup (MFontset *fontset, MSymbol script,
                                MSymbol language, MSymbol charset);
-
+/*** @}   */
 /* end of fontset module */
 /*=*/